如何在YUI中绑定和触发自定义和本机事件?

时间:2011-03-15 13:07:28

标签: javascript events yui yui3

我正在尝试使用YUI绑定并触发以下事件,但到目前为止,触发它们时似乎没有任何事件触发。

我要绑定的代码:

        YUI().use('node-base', function(Y){
            Y.one(el).on(event,callback);
        });

我的触发代码:

        YUI().use('node-event-simulate', function(Y){
            Y.one(el).simulate(event);
        });

event变量可以是以下任何字符串:

  • statechange(自定义事件)
  • anchorchange(自定义事件)
  • hashchange(有时是原生事件,取决于浏览器功能)
  • popstate(有时是原生事件,取决于浏览器功能)

el变量通常是window dom元素,但也可能是选择器和其他dom元素。

这是我目前尝试让它在YUI中运行: http://jsfiddle.net/balupton/tFbum/

以下是我想在jQuery中工作的内容:http://jsfiddle.net/balupton/862Lg/

谢谢你们: - )

1 个答案:

答案 0 :(得分:1)

看起来目前还不可能。